# Break-Glass Access — Sproutline Scheduler

External plugin authors for the Sproutline plant-watering scheduler may occasionally need emergency access when the plugin sandbox vault seals itself during a failed certification run. Use this procedure only after two normal unlock attempts fail, and record the incident in your plugin changelog. Open the sandbox console, select emergency unseal, and enter the recovery passphrase provided below.

unlock words, hahip-baduf: holwyn-istath-julvan

The RateMirror parity endpoint compares published room rates across connected channels and flags discrepancies above your configured threshold. Plugin authors should poll no more than once per property per hour; bursts beyond this are throttled with a 429 response. All comparison requests must be signed and routed through the Lanternwick gateway, which validates your plugin manifest before forwarding. To authenticate against the internal parity service, include the key below in the X-Parity-Auth header.

service key, fawip-bajef: kto11_Qt5wZK9vdNC

## Formula sandbox tuning

User-supplied formulas in Gridmoor execute inside a restricted interpreter with hard ceilings on time, memory, and call depth. Reviewers should confirm any change to these ceilings is justified in the PR description, since raising them widens the abuse surface. Defaults were chosen from production traces. The current limits are as follows.

limits module of tafog-fawip:
WEIGHTS = {
    "julix": 57,
    "lamys": 992,
    "kasvan": 209,
    "quenok": 750,
    "alddor": 259,
    "oliath": 1009,
    "wenix": 815,
}

# Telemetry client setup for the Cropline gateway.
#
# This client pushes tractor and baler telemetry from field units to the
# Cropline ingest gateway. Batches flush every 30 seconds or at 500 events,
# whichever comes first. Retries use exponential backoff; don't change the
# cap without talking to the ingest team, since the gateway rate-limits per
# device fleet. The client authenticates against the internal fleet-auth
# service, not the public edge. The key used for the staging fleet follows.

gateway credential: kto23_dolYgAScEh2TaPOlStqOl98